960px-Beyond_the_Gates_%282025_logo%29.s

original release date: Friday, May 22, 2026 | writers: Jamey Giddens, Jazmen Darnell Brown | director: Michael V. Pomarico

Thoughts:

  • Joey trying to gaslight Donnell is not right. Donnell has always been honest and upfront with Joey, so to be treating him like this feels like a complete slap in the damn face.

  • Another hospital? Damn. Sounds like the shooting really uprooted everything at Garland Memorial. But Ted, you want your ex-wife to talk to your current girlfriend? That has got to be interesting and also a potential conflict of interest, no?

  • How awkward... meeting your girlfriend's/ex-friend's mother following the death of her ex-boyfriend. Wow.

  • Jan's love for Derek ran deep... she wanted him more than Ashley ever did. Ha.

  • I admire that Grayson is a person of his word... but I do not think, right now, at this very moment, is the right time for him to do it.

  • I am not surprised at Anita and Vernon believing Monica would be a solid replacement for Lia as chief of staff. I think that is a fantastic choice. Of course Ted would want Nicole to do it, though.

  • Donnell, do not back down to Joey. Stand ten toes down. You have got this. And I feel like, unlike Deanna and your mother, you might be able to make some kind of impact/leeway with Joey.

  • Damn. Even Andre is having doubts about how things went down between him and Ashley and how Derek was involved with that. Insanity. And Dani is right; there is no guarantee that the end result could have been any different.

  • Ashley, Ash... Derek does not own nicknames. I know you are heartbroken and grieving, but Grayson is not the reason why. I just hope Grayson can understand that right now.

  • As much as I do not want to agree with her... Katherine might actually be right about Deanna's approach towards Vanessa.

  • I like that, despite everything, Dani is embracing Ashley during her time of mourning.

  • I hate to say it but Nicole dating Carlton and Kial is not the same as you dating Joey, Vanessa. Sorry, but it is not.

  • Nicole, you did check Katherine, but she needed to be checked more and harder because she continues to act like she was raised in a damn barn.

  • OH DAMN! Douglas. Now, is he really there, or is he an apparition? That is interesting. Whew. Ballsy, even.

Notes:

  • Was hoping writer2 would not pop up this week. Ugh. But they did. One of their better breakdowns, but I do think that is because they had to continue the momentum from the other episodes this week, so their hand was likely forced. And per usual, Brown did outstanding dialogue.

  • Pomarico did some solid work today as director. He does tight shots exceptionally well.

  • Much like Daphnée Duplaix's wig, Karla Mosley's wig is way too flat. This is the first hairstyle she has had that I am not a fan of.

  • Jen Jacob (Ashley) continues to do fantastic work. She is really digging into the emotional pull of the material she is being given to deliver. Kudos to her.

  • Keith D. Robinson (Ted) can wear any colour suit. The burnt orange on him was absolutely stunning today. Very crisp and clean.

  • Welcome back to Jason Graham (Douglas). It is very nice seeing him!
